Tucana
name
Definitions
Proper Noun
- 1 A spring constellation of the southern sky, said to resemble a toucan. It lies south of the constellations Phoenix and Grus.
Etymology
Named by Dutch explorers Pieter Dirkszoon Keyser and Frederick de Houtman between 1595 and 1597. From later Latin tucana (“toucan”).
